Ebola outbreak in eastern DRC expands: governance, testing and treatment gaps as deaths top 500
The Bundibugyo Ebola outbreak in eastern Democratic Republic of the Congo has widened, with reported fatalities now above 500. National health authorities, the World Health Organization, local clinics, affected communities and international partners are all involved in the response. The scale of deaths, the appearance of a less-common Ebola species, pressure to speed up diagnostics and the search for effective therapies, and the risk of cross-border spread have focused attention from media, civil society and regulators.

Background and timeline
The Bundibugyo outbreak emerged in eastern DRC earlier this year. What began as localized clusters, despite containment efforts, expanded into wider transmission across multiple health zones. National surveillance teams, backed by WHO rapid response units, carried out case investigations, contact tracing and isolation. As the situation evolved, reported deaths climbed past 500. WHO and UN reports have stressed the need to speed up diagnostics and collect data on treatment outcomes specific to Bundibugyo, a species seen less often in recent global outbreaks than Zaire ebolavirus.
Sequence of events (factual narrative)
- Detection: Local clinicians and surveillance systems spotted an unusual cluster of viral haemorrhagic illness and sent samples to reference laboratories for confirmation.
- Confirmation: Laboratories identified Bundibugyo as the cause; national authorities declared an outbreak and notified WHO under International Health Regulations.
- Initial response: Rapid response teams were deployed for case management, contact tracing and infection prevention and control; emergency resources were directed to affected provinces.
- Escalation: Despite containment efforts, cases spread to more health zones; cumulative reported deaths rose above 500, prompting greater international technical support and calls to accelerate testing and treatment research.

Operational gaps and practical constraints
Several operational issues are limiting the response: scarce molecular testing at the provincial level, delays moving samples to national reference labs, shortages of personal protective equipment and isolation beds in some health zones, and too few clinicians with experience managing severe viral haemorrhagic fever. Logistics - roads, security and cold-chain needs for specimens and therapeutics - remain major hurdles. Addressing these will need short-term surge funding and longer-term investment in decentralized lab and clinical capacity.
Evidence and research needs
Because Bundibugyo is rarer than other Ebola species, there are fewer clinical trials and observational data on therapeutic effectiveness. The priority is to speed up ethically approved trials or coordinated registries that collect standardized outcomes while protecting patients and ensuring community consent. Faster validation and rollout of point-of-care diagnostics would reduce clinical uncertainty and improve triage, but new tests need regulatory review and provider training.
